Autism therapists in The Acreage, Florida Statistics

Autism therapists in The Acreage, Florida average 15 years of experience and charge around $205 per session. 98%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(67%), Acceptance & Commitment Therapy (ACT) (44%), and Behavioral Therapy (34%).
